Pavers Landscaping in Boston, MA
Pavers landscaping services encompass the installation, repair, and customization of paved surfaces such as walkways, patios, driveways, and outdoor entertainment areas. These projects often involve selecting durable materials like brick, stone, or concrete pavers to enhance curb appeal and functionality. Property owners interested in pavers typically want to understand the different styles and patterns available, the suitability of various materials for their specific property, and the overall maintenance requirements to ensure long-lasting results.
Before requesting pavers landscaping services, homeowners should consider factors such as the intended use of the paved area, existing landscape features, and drainage needs. It’s also helpful to have a clear idea of the desired design aesthetic and any specific preferences for color or pattern. Property owners are encouraged to discuss their goals and property conditions with a professional to determine the best options for their outdoor space.

Pavers Landsc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for pavers? Pavers are ideal for driveways, patios, walkways, and outdoor seating areas, providing durable and attractive surfaces.
What materials are commonly used for paver landscaping?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etics and durability.
How do pavers improve property appearance? Pavers create a polished, organized look that enhances curb appeal and defines outdoor spaces effectively.
Are pavers suitable for areas with heavy foot traffic? Yes, pavers are designed to withstand frequent use and provide a stable, long-lasting surface.
